तव पादाबुंजद्वंद्वे निर्द्वंद्वा भक्तिरस्तु नः । आ कलेवरपातं च काशीवासोस्तु नोनिशम्
tava pādābuṃjadvaṃdve nirdvaṃdvā bhaktirastu naḥ | ā kalevarapātaṃ ca kāśīvāsostu noniśam
Möge uns unerschütterliche Hingabe an Deine beiden Lotosfüße zuteilwerden; und möge uns das Wohnen in Kāśī unablässig gehören, bis zum Fall des Leibes (Tod).
